LinuxUbuntu安装VMware tools Segmentation fault (core dumped)怎么解决
在安装VMware Tools时遇到"Segmentation fault (core dumped)"错误,通常是由于兼容性问题或系统配置不正确导致的。以下是一些可能的解决方法:
1.检查VMware Tools兼容性:确保你使用的是与你的VMware虚拟机版本相匹配的VMware Tools。在安装之前,查看VMware官方文档,确认你下载了正确版本的VMware Tools。
2.更新操作系统和内核:使用apt-get或apt命令更新你的Ubuntu操作系统和内核。运行以下命令更新软件包:
sudo apt-get update sudo apt-get upgrade sudo apt-get dist-upgrade
然后重启系统,再试一次安装VMware Tools。
3.检查和安装必需的依赖项:确保安装了VMware Tools所需的依赖项。运行以下命令:
sudo apt-get install build-essential sudo apt-get install linux-headers-$(uname -r)
安装了构建工具和Linux内核标头之后,再次尝试安装VMware Tools。
4.禁用Secure Boot:如果你的Ubuntu系统启用了Secure Boot,尝试禁用它。启用Secure Boot可能会导致一些模块无法正确加载,从而导致错误。你可以在BIOS或UEFI设置中禁用Secure Boot。
5.尝试手动安装:你可以尝试手动安装VMware Tools。首先,在VMware虚拟机上选择安装VMware Tools选项,然后将安装介质挂载到虚拟机中。解压缩安装介质,并在终端内导航到解压缩的文件夹。运行以下命令手动安装:
sudo ./vmware-install.pl
按照提示完成安装过程。
6.在VMware官方社区寻求帮助:如果以上方法仍然无法解决问题,你可以在VMware官方社区或论坛中寻求帮助。在社区中,你可以提问并与其他用户和VMware专家讨论该问题。
这些方法应该能够帮助你解决"Segmentation fault (core dumped)"错误并成功安装VMware Tools。如果问题仍然存在,建议咨询VMware支持团队的帮助。
总结:VMware tools Segmentation fault (core dumped)表示 tools 的版本和当前系统版本不一致,请下载对应版本就好。下载方式只需要使用apt 安装就好。他会自己安装对应的正确版本。
贴一个体验不错的学习链接恰饭:学习链接